Abstract
With the continuous development of new technologies such as global data, the internet, machine translation and speech recognition, language service industry, language education industry and even relevant vertical areas have undergone a series of profound changes. How to integrate innovation and breakthrough in translation teaching, scientific research and practice has becomes an urgent problem to be solved. Big data and artificial intelligence has brought new opportunities for the development of education, and language services play the core values of language for the “going out” of Chinese culture.
